The Epson M188B is the model name for the Epson TM-U220B impact receipt printer. This model is a staple in the hospitality and retail industries, primarily used as a kitchen or receipt printer due to its durable dot matrix printing and integrated auto-cutter. Drivers & Software
To ensure compatibility with modern operating systems like Windows 11, you should download the latest drivers directly from official sources:
EPSON Advanced Printer Driver (APD): This is the standard driver for Windows environments. The most recent version (e.g., v4.59) supports English and various regional models.
TM Virtual Port Driver: Essential if you are using a USB connection but your POS software requires a Serial (COM) or Parallel (LPT) port to communicate. Official Downloads:

To understand the necessity of a driver, one must first recognize the fundamental disconnect between hardware and software. Operating systems like Windows 11 or Linux are built to be generalized; they are designed to handle millions of different tasks and communicate with countless varieties of machinery. Conversely, a machine like an impact receipt printer is highly specialized. It does not understand web pages, spreadsheets, or raw digital text. It only understands specific mechanical commands telling its print head when to strike the ribbon against the paper. The device driver bridges this gap. When a retail employee completes a transaction, the POS software sends a high-level command to print. The driver intercepts this command and translates it into the precise binary language required by that specific machine.

Hardware like the Epson TM-U220 is legendary for its physical durability. Built to withstand the heat, grease, and heavy use of commercial kitchens and bustling retail counters, these impact printers often outlive the computers that control them by decades. However, physical longevity means nothing without digital compatibility. When a business upgrades its main computer network to a new operating system, old drivers often break. Without dedicated developers continuously updating software to ensure these machines can communicate with modern 64-bit architectures or cloud-based POS systems, perfectly functional, multi-million dollar fleets of hardware would be rendered useless overnight.
Furthermore, driver development is not merely about maintaining the status quo; it is also about unlocking new potentials in older hardware. Modern Advanced Printer Drivers (APD) do more than just relay text. They allow older impact printers to execute complex tasks such as intelligent paper-cutting, dual-color printing (rendering kitchen modifications in bold red), and seamless integration with wireless or Ethernet network adapters. By updating the digital brain of the operation, businesses can enjoy the perks of modern digital infrastructure without paying the exorbitant costs of replacing their entire physical inventory. To set up the Epson M188B (widely known as the TM-U220 series), follow this guide to install the latest drivers and configure the hardware. 1. Identify Your Interface
The M188B model has several versions depending on the connection port:
USB: Requires a virtual port driver for proper communication. Ethernet (LAN): Common for kitchen or bar printers.
Serial (RS-232) or Parallel: Legacy connections usually requiring manual port assignment. 2. Download the Latest Drivers
